Function 1
Function descriptionO-GlcNAc transferase glycosyltransferase that mediates beta-O-linked GlcNAc modification of flagellin (FlaA)
References for functionShen A, Kamp HD, Gr?ndling A, Higgins DE. A bifunctional O-GlcNAc transferase governs flagellar motility through anti-repression. Genes Dev. 2006 Dec 1. PMID: 17158746
E.C. number2.4.1.255

Function 2
Function descriptiontranscriptional regulator anti-repressor, target is MogR (a transcriptional repressor), binds to MogR and prevents it from binding to DNA
References for functionShen A, Kamp HD, Gr?ndling A, Higgins DE. A bifunctional O-GlcNAc transferase governs flagellar motility through anti-repression. Genes Dev. 2006 Dec 1. PMID: 17158746
